The Urgency Of Quick Water Damage Remediation For Homeowners

Water damage is one of the most urgent and potentially devastating problems a property owner can face. Water in the wrong place from a burst pipe, flooding, leaking roof or appliance failure may rapidly become a serious issue. The key to minimizing the lasting effects of water damage lies in one critical factor: quick response.

Why Speed Matters?

When water invades a home or business, every minute counts. Water spreads rapidly, seeping into walls, floors, and even the foundation. The longer it sits, the more damage it can cause. Materials such as drywall, carpet, insulation, and wood are highly absorbent and vulnerable to deterioration. Untreated water damage can cause costly repairs, structural issues, and health risks. Water damage must be addressed quickly to stop this chain reaction.

Minimizing Structural Damage

One of the most serious consequences of water damage is the weakening of a building’s structure. Water penetrates porous materials, causing wood to warp, metal to corrode, and drywall to crumble. Over time, this compromises the integrity of floors, walls, and ceilings. A rapid response helps to remove the water and begin the drying process before these materials are irreversibly damaged. Early action can avoid costly structural repairs and rebuilds and save thousands of dollars.

Preventing Mold Growth

Mold is often the unseen danger following water damage. Mold spores are naturally present but need moisture to thrive. Within 24 to 48 hours after water exposure, mold can begin to colonize and spread. Mold causes breathing issues and allergic reactions and degrades building materials. Quick water extraction and thorough drying dramatically reduce the likelihood of mold growth, protecting both the property and the occupants’ health.

Protecting Personal Belongings

Beyond the structure itself, water damage threatens the personal belongings inside a property. Furniture, electronics, photographs, documents, and textiles can be ruined within hours of exposure. While some items can be salvaged with prompt remediation, delays often result in permanent loss. A swift response ensures that water is removed quickly and affected items can be assessed and treated to maximize recovery.

Reducing Financial Loss And Insurance Complications

Delays in addressing water damage can increase the overall cost of restoration dramatically. The longer water remains, the more extensive the damage, leading to higher repair bills. Insurance companies also emphasize timely reporting and response when evaluating claims. Failure to act quickly can complicate the claims process or reduce compensation. Responding rapidly to water damage demonstrates due diligence, helping to facilitate smoother interactions with insurers and potentially expediting financial recovery.

The Role Of Professional Remediation Services

While immediate action by property owners—such as shutting off water sources and removing small amounts of water—can help, professional water damage remediation companies are essential for a thorough response. These experts have the equipment and training to assess damage, extract water, and dry and dehumidify the home. They also perform critical tasks such as disinfecting affected areas and monitoring moisture levels to prevent hidden damage.

Professional teams typically offer 24/7 emergency services because water damage can happen at any time, and waiting is never advisable. Their fast mobilization to the site is crucial in containing the damage and beginning the restoration process.

Modern water damage remediation relies heavily on advanced drying technology such as industrial fans, air movers, and dehumidifiers. These tools accelerate evaporation and moisture removal, which are vital in halting the deterioration of building materials and mold growth. However, their effectiveness diminishes as time passes. The sooner the drying process begins after water intrusion, the more efficient it will be, resulting in faster recovery and less damage.
